Studying for a Master of Clinical Pharmacy in Sunbury opens up avenues for aspiring pharmacists looking to advance their careers. The region, located just 40 kilometres north-west of Melbourne, has a growing demand for skilled pharmacy professionals. With two reputable training providers in the area, including the University of Queensland and the University of Tasmania, students can choose to study through online delivery mode, making education accessible and flexible for those residing in Sunbury.
The Master of Clinical Pharmacy course covers extensive aspects of the pharmacy field, ensuring graduates are well-prepared for diverse roles such as a Pharmaceutical Scientist, Community Pharmacist, or Clinical Pharmacist.
